News: West End production of Dreamgirls to commence first ever UK tour

Multi-award winning West End production of Dreamgirls is set to embark on its first ever UK tour from December 2021, starring Nicole Raquel Dennis as Effie White.

Presented by Sonia Friedman Productions, the show was due to begin in 2020 and was delayed due to the pandemic. The musical will now open at the Liverpool Empire Theatre this festive season, before visiting venues across the country throughout 2022 and into 2023.

Meet The Dreams – Effie, Lorrell and Deena – three talented young singers in the turbulent 1960s, a revolutionary time in American music history. Join the three friends as they embark upon a musical rollercoaster ride through a world of fame, fortune and the ruthless realities of show business, testing their friendships to the very limit.

Packed with sensational showstoppers including “And I Am Telling You I’m Not Going”, “Listen” and “One Night Only”, plus many more, this dazzling production first had its acclaimed West End premiere in December 2016 at the Savoy Theatre.

Dreamgirls UK tour stars Nicole Raquel Dennis as Effie White, with stage credits including Dear Evan Hansen (BBTA winner for Best Supporting Actress in a Musical), as well as Waitress and The Book of Mormon.

Dennis was also a inalist on ITV’s The Voice in 2019, performing Dreamgirls’ mega-hit “And I Am Telling You I’m Not Going” alongside Jennifer Hudson.

Further casting is to be announced soon.

Dreamgirls is directed and Choreographed by Olivier and Tony Award-winner Casey Nicholaw (The Book of Mormon, Mean Girls, Disney’s Aladdin and Something Rotten!), with set and costume design by Tim Hatley, lighting design by Hugh Vanstone, sound design by Richard Brooker, hair design by Josh Marquette and music supervision by Nick Finlow.

The show features book and lyrics by Tom Eyen and music by Henry Krieger, with additional material by Willie Reale.
